New Raith EBL: tool up
It appears that the combination of higher beam currents than usual (we did after all upgrade our EBL capabilities for the purpose of higher throughput at much higher beam currents) and the particular (extremely sparse) stitch patterns we use to measure stitch accuracy revealed a subtle limitation in the Fine Focus coil used in their systems (the Fine Focus coil adjusts focal point on the substrate as the beam is deflected around the 1mm field). We are working with the tool designers in Eindhoven as well as the service team in the US to “fix” this issue. However, in the meantime, we understand and recognize the problem sufficiently to address it if it comes up in real day-to-day usage.
We will be signing off on the tool tomorrow morning at which point the tool will be available for general EBL use to our nanofab community. I will be working with a few experienced users in the next couple of days and then will be reaching out to a wider audience to get more of you trained. -- Bill Mitchell // Demis D.
